American politician (1845-1905)
Lloyd Lowndes Jr., a member of the United States Republican Party, was an American attorney and politician, the 43rd governor of Maryland from 1896 to 1900 and a member of the U.S. House of Representatives from the sixth district of Maryland from 1873 to 1875.
